Dalam dunia jaringan komputer, pemahaman tentang pengaturan alamat IP sangatlah penting. Salah satu protokol yang berperan besar dalam pengelolaan alamat IP adalah DHCP, atau Dynamic Host Configuration Protocol. Artikel ini akan membahas secara mendalam tentang apa itu DHCP, bagaimana fungsinya, dan cara kerjanya dalam konteks jaringan dan jasa pembuatan website profesional. Seiring berkembangnya teknologi dan kebutuhan akan koneksi internet yang stabil, DHCP menjadi solusi efisien untuk mengelola pengalamatan IP secara otomatis. Melalui artikel ini, Anda akan mendapatkan pemahaman yang lebih baik tentang peran DHCP dalam jaringan, serta bagaimana penerapannya dapat mendukung jasa pembuatan website profesional dengan memberikan infrastruktur yang handal dan efisien. Mari kita eksplor lebih lanjut!
Pengertian DHCP
Dynamic Host Configuration Protocol (DHCP) adalah sebuah protokol jaringan yang digunakan untuk mengelola pengalamatan IP secara otomatis dalam sebuah jaringan. DHCP memungkinkan server untuk memberikan alamat IP kepada perangkat (klien) yang terhubung ke jaringan, sehingga perangkat tersebut dapat berkomunikasi dengan perangkat lain dan akses internet tanpa memerlukan konfigurasi manual.
DHCP berfungsi dengan cara menyediakan informasi penting lainnya selain alamat IP, seperti:
- Subnet Mask: Memisahkan bagian jaringan dari bagian host dalam alamat IP.
- Gateway: Alamat IP dari router yang menghubungkan jaringan lokal dengan jaringan lainnya.
- DNS Server: Alamat server yang digunakan untuk menerjemahkan nama domain menjadi alamat IP.
Dengan menggunakan DHCP, administrator jaringan dapat mengurangi beban kerja dalam pengaturan jaringan, meminimalisir kesalahan yang mungkin terjadi akibat konfigurasi manual, dan memastikan bahwa setiap perangkat mendapatkan alamat IP yang unik dan valid. Protokol ini sangat penting dalam lingkungan jaringan yang besar dan dinamis, seperti di perusahaan-perusahaan dan penyedia layanan internet.
Fungsi DHCP
Dynamic Host Configuration Protocol (DHCP) memiliki beberapa fungsi utama yang sangat penting dalam pengelolaan jaringan komputer:
- Otomatisasi Pengalamatan IP: DHCP secara otomatis memberikan alamat IP kepada perangkat yang terhubung ke jaringan. Hal ini mengeliminasi kebutuhan untuk konfigurasi manual, yang dapat memakan waktu dan rentan terhadap kesalahan.
- Penyediaan Informasi Jaringan: Selain alamat IP, DHCP juga menyediakan informasi penting lainnya, seperti subnet mask, gateway, dan server DNS. Ini memungkinkan perangkat untuk berfungsi dengan baik dalam jaringan.
- Pengelolaan Alamat IP: DHCP mengelola pool alamat IP yang tersedia, memastikan setiap perangkat mendapatkan alamat yang unik dan menghindari konflik alamat IP.
- Memudahkan Perubahan Jaringan: Ketika ada perubahan dalam konfigurasi jaringan, seperti penambahan atau pengurangan perangkat, DHCP dapat secara otomatis menyesuaikan pengalamatan tanpa memerlukan intervensi manual.
- Dukungan untuk Jaringan Besar: Dalam jaringan yang luas dan dinamis, DHCP memungkinkan pengelolaan yang efisien, memudahkan administrator untuk menambah dan menghapus perangkat tanpa komplikasi.
Cara Kerja DHCP
Cara kerja Dynamic Host Configuration Protocol (DHCP) melibatkan beberapa langkah yang terstruktur dalam proses pengalamatan IP. Berikut adalah tahapan utama dalam cara kerja DHCP:
- DHCP Discover: Ketika perangkat (klien) terhubung ke jaringan, perangkat tersebut mengirimkan pesan broadcast yang dikenal sebagai DHCP Discover. Pesan ini memberi tahu bahwa perangkat mencari server DHCP untuk mendapatkan alamat IP.
- DHCP Offer: Server DHCP yang menerima pesan Discover akan merespons dengan mengirimkan pesan DHCP Offer. Pesan ini berisi alamat IP yang tersedia, serta informasi jaringan lainnya seperti subnet mask, gateway, dan DNS server.
- DHCP Request: Setelah menerima beberapa penawaran dari server DHCP, klien memilih satu penawaran dan mengirimkan pesan DHCP Request kembali ke server yang dipilih. Ini menandakan bahwa klien ingin menerima alamat IP yang ditawarkan.
- DHCP Acknowledgment (ACK): Server DHCP kemudian mengonfirmasi permintaan klien dengan mengirimkan pesan DHCP Acknowledgment (ACK). Pesan ini menyatakan bahwa alamat IP telah dialokasikan kepada klien, dan informasi jaringan lainnya juga disertakan untuk konfigurasi lebih lanjut.
- Penggunaan Alamat IP: Setelah menerima ACK, klien mengonfigurasi dirinya sendiri dengan alamat IP dan informasi jaringan yang diterima, sehingga dapat mulai berkomunikasi di jaringan.
Tabel 1. Pengertian DHCP dan Komponen Utamanya
| Komponen DHCP | Penjelasan Singkat |
|---|---|
| DHCP (Dynamic Host Configuration Protocol) | Protokol jaringan untuk memberikan konfigurasi IP secara otomatis |
| DHCP Server | Perangkat/server yang membagikan IP address ke client |
| DHCP Client | Perangkat yang menerima IP (komputer, HP, printer, router) |
| IP Address | Alamat unik perangkat dalam jaringan |
| Lease Time | Durasi penggunaan IP address oleh client |
| Scope DHCP | Rentang IP address yang boleh dibagikan |
Tabel 2. Fungsi DHCP dalam Jaringan Komputer
| Fungsi DHCP | Penjelasan | Manfaat Utama |
|---|---|---|
| Otomatisasi IP address | IP diberikan tanpa konfigurasi manual | Menghemat waktu & tenaga |
| Mengurangi human error | Menghindari konflik IP | Jaringan lebih stabil |
| Manajemen jaringan terpusat | Pengaturan IP dari satu server | Mudah dikontrol |
| Mendukung jaringan besar | Cocok untuk banyak perangkat | Skalabilitas tinggi |
| Efisiensi administrasi | Minim konfigurasi manual | Operasional lebih efisien |
Tabel 3. Cara Kerja DHCP (Proses DORA)
| Tahap Proses | Nama Tahap | Penjelasan Proses |
|---|---|---|
| 1 | Discover | Client mencari DHCP server di jaringan |
| 2 | Offer | Server menawarkan IP address ke client |
| 3 | Request | Client meminta IP yang ditawarkan |
| 4 | Acknowledge | Server menyetujui dan memberikan konfigurasi IP |
Keuntungan Menggunakan DHCP
Menggunakan Dynamic Host Configuration Protocol (DHCP) dalam jaringan komputer menawarkan berbagai keuntungan yang signifikan. Salah satu keuntungan utama adalah otomatisasi pengalamatan IP, yang mengurangi kebutuhan untuk konfigurasi manual. Dengan DHCP, perangkat yang terhubung ke jaringan secara otomatis mendapatkan alamat IP dan informasi jaringan lainnya, sehingga menghemat waktu dan tenaga administrator jaringan.
Selain itu, DHCP juga mengoptimalkan penggunaan alamat IP. Dalam jaringan besar, sulit untuk memastikan bahwa semua alamat IP digunakan secara efisien. DHCP memungkinkan administrator untuk mengelola dan memproses banyak permintaan klien secara bersamaan, sehingga meminimalkan risiko konflik alamat IP 1.
Keuntungan lainnya adalah kemudahan dalam pengelolaan jaringan. Ketika ada perubahan, seperti penambahan atau pengurangan perangkat, DHCP dapat menyesuaikan pengalamatan tanpa memerlukan intervensi manual, yang membuat pengelolaan jaringan menjadi lebih fleksibel dan responsif.
DHCP juga mendukung penggunaan alamat IP yang dapat digunakan kembali. Alamat IP yang tidak aktif dapat dialokasikan kembali kepada perangkat lain, sehingga meningkatkan efisiensi penggunaan sumber daya jaringan.
Penerapan DHCP dalam Aktivitas Digital
Dalam konteks jasa pembuatan website profesional, penerapan Dynamic Host Configuration Protocol (DHCP) sangat penting untuk memastikan bahwa semua perangkat yang terhubung ke jaringan dapat berfungsi dengan baik. Ketika sebuah perusahaan jasa pembuatan website mengembangkan situs untuk klien, mereka sering kali harus mengelola banyak perangkat, termasuk server, komputer pengembang, dan perangkat pengujian.
Dengan menggunakan DHCP, perusahaan dapat secara otomatis memberikan alamat IP kepada semua perangkat yang terhubung ke jaringan. Ini mengurangi waktu yang diperlukan untuk konfigurasi manual dan meminimalkan risiko kesalahan yang dapat terjadi saat menetapkan alamat IP secara manual. Selain itu, DHCP memungkinkan pengelolaan yang lebih efisien dari sumber daya jaringan, yang sangat penting ketika banyak proyek sedang dikerjakan secara bersamaan.
Penerapan DHCP juga mendukung pengujian dan pengembangan yang lebih cepat. Ketika pengembang perlu menambahkan atau menghapus perangkat dari jaringan. Disinilah peran DHCP memungkinkan mereka untuk melakukannya dengan mudah tanpa harus mengubah pengaturan jaringan secara keseluruhan. Ini sangat berguna dalam lingkungan yang dinamis, di mana perangkat baru sering kali ditambahkan untuk pengujian atau pengembangan.
Kesimpulan
Kesimpulan adalah ringkasan atau hasil akhir dari suatu analisis, penelitian, atau diskusi yang menyajikan poin-poin utama dan temuan yang diperoleh. Dalam konteks pembuatan website profesional, kesimpulan dapat mencakup evaluasi tentang efektivitas penggunaan teknologi, seperti Dynamic Host Configuration Protocol (DHCP). Ini berpera terutama dalam meningkatkan efisiensi dan produktivitas tim pengembang.
Penerapan DHCP dalam jaringan memungkinkan otomatisasi pengalamatan IP, yang mengurangi waktu dan usaha yang diperlukan untuk konfigurasi manual. Hal ini tidak hanya mempermudah pengelolaan perangkat yang terhubung, tetapi juga mendukung pengembangan dan pengujian yang lebih cepat. Dengan demikian, penggunaan DHCP berkontribusi pada kelancaran proses pembuatan website. Disamping itu juga DHCP membantu memastikan bahwa proyek dapat diselesaikan dengan lebih efisien dan tepat waktu.
Secara keseluruhan, kesimpulan dari penerapan DHCP dalam jasa pembuatan website profesional menunjukkan bahwa teknologi ini sangat bermanfaat dalam menciptakan lingkungan kerja yang lebih terorganisir dan responsif. Hingga pada akhirnya dapat membantu meningkatkan kepuasan klien dan kualitas produk akhir.
FAQ
DHCP (Dynamic Host Configuration Protocol) adalah protokol jaringan yang berfungsi memberikan IP address dan konfigurasi jaringan secara otomatis kepada perangkat. DHCP penting karena mempermudah pengelolaan jaringan, mengurangi kesalahan konfigurasi, dan memastikan setiap perangkat dapat terhubung dengan benar.
DHCP memberikan IP address secara otomatis dan dapat berubah sesuai lease time, sedangkan IP statis ditetapkan secara manual dan bersifat tetap. DHCP cocok untuk jaringan dengan banyak perangkat, sementara IP statis biasanya digunakan untuk server atau perangkat yang membutuhkan alamat tetap.
DHCP bekerja melalui empat tahap utama yang dikenal sebagai proses DORA: Discover (client mencari server), Offer (server menawarkan IP), Request (client meminta IP), dan Acknowledge (server menyetujui dan memberikan IP). Proses ini terjadi secara otomatis saat perangkat terhubung ke jaringan.
Jika DHCP server tidak tersedia, perangkat tidak akan mendapatkan IP address secara otomatis. Akibatnya, perangkat bisa gagal terhubung ke jaringan atau hanya mendapatkan IP sementara (APIPA) yang tidak dapat digunakan untuk akses internet.
Tidak semua jaringan wajib menggunakan DHCP, tetapi sebagian besar jaringan modern sangat terbantu dengan DHCP. Jaringan kecil masih bisa menggunakan IP statis, namun untuk jaringan menengah hingga besar, DHCP jauh lebih efisien dan mudah dikelola.
Secara umum DHCP aman digunakan, namun tetap perlu pengamanan tambahan seperti pembatasan akses DHCP server dan penggunaan firewall. Tanpa pengamanan, jaringan berisiko mengalami serangan seperti rogue DHCP.
DHCP server bisa berupa router, server jaringan (seperti Windows Server atau Linux), atau perangkat jaringan lain yang memiliki fitur DHCP. Pada jaringan rumah dan kantor kecil, router biasanya berperan sebagai DHCP server.